CVE-2023-44382: Improper Control of Generation of Code ('Code Injection')

December 1, 2023 (updated December 6, 2023)

October is a Content Management System (CMS) and web platform to assist with development workflow. An authenticated backend user with the editor.cms_pages, editor.cms_layouts, or editor.cms_partials permissions who would normally not be permitted to provide PHP code to be executed by the CMS due to cms.safe_mode being enabled can write specific Twig code to escape the Twig sandbox and execute arbitrary PHP. This issue has been patched in 3.4.15.

Affected versions

All versions starting from 3.0.0 before 3.4.15

Fixed versions

  • 3.5.0

Solution

Upgrade to version 3.5.0 or above.

Impact 9.1 CRITICAL

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H

Learn more about CVSS

Weakness

  • CWE-94: Improper Control of Generation of Code ('Code Injection')
